show ip device tracking all

Use this command to display all the IPv4DT (IPv4/VLAN/MAC) entries in the IPv4DT table.

Format show ip device tracking all [active|inactive]
Mode Privileged EXEC
Parameter Description
active (Optional) Displays only the ACTIVE status entries.
inactive (Optional) Displays only the INACTIVE status entries.

The following fields are displayed in the output of this command.

Field Description
IP Address The learned IPv4 address of the device.
MAC Address The MAC address associated with the learned IPv4 address.
VLAN The VLAN ID associated with an interface on which the device is learned.
Interface The interface name on which the device is learned.
Time left to inactive The number of seconds before the reachable device is set to INACTIVE.
Time since inactive The number of seconds since the INACTIVE device was last reachable.
State Specifies the device is in ACTIVE or INACTIVE state.
Source Specifies the source of the device whether it is ARP, DHCP, or Static.

Example: The following shows example CLI display output for the command.

(Switching) #show ip device tracking all

IP Device Tracking for clients......................... Enable
IP Device Tracking Probe Generation.................... Enable
IP Device Tracking Probe Count......................... 3
IP Device Tracking Probe Interval.......................30
IP Device Tracking Probe Delay Interval.................30
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
IP Address  MAC Address      Vlan Interface Time-left   Time-since State Source
                                            to inactive inactive
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
10.21.1.1   01:02:03:04:05:06 2   1/0/1     30          0          ACTIVE   ARP

Total number interfaces enabled: 1

Enabled interfaces:
1/0/1
